Ramadan 2026: India Awaits Moon Sighting Tonight for First Roza Tomorrow, Feb 19
- •India awaits tonight's moon sighting to confirm the start of Ramadan 2026, with the first Roza anticipated for Thursday, February 19.
- •Saudi Arabia confirmed the crescent moon sighting yesterday, with fasting beginning today, February 18, in Gulf nations.
- •Local moon sighting committees in major Indian cities like Delhi, Lucknow, Hyderabad, and Mumbai will observe the moon after sunset prayers.
- •If the moon is sighted tonight, the first day of fasting in India will be February 19; otherwise, Ramadan will begin on February 20.
- •Households are preparing for Sehri and Iftar, with timings varying by city, and Chand Raat 2026 marking the festive eve.
